Help Is Here: Rep. Cleaver Announces Over $7.5 Billion in American Rescue Plan Payments Have Gone to Hardworking Missourians This Year

Press Release

Today, U.S. Representative Emanuel Cleaver, II (D-MO) announced that hardworking Missourians throughout the State have received over 3.1 million Economic Impact Payments totaling more than $7.5 billion in 2021. The Economic Impact Payments were secured as part of the American Rescue Plan, a transformative relief package Congressman Cleaver helped to pass in March.

Thanks to the American Rescue Plan, more than 163 million Americans received Economic Impact Payments of up to $1,400 this year. More than half of this direct relief has gone to households making less than $50,000.
